  3. Syamantak says:

    email or phone call will not initiate a closure of account. you may like to walk into nearby service point and fill up the closure form. You need to return back the unused TI slips along with the closure form. Keep the acknowledgement copy for your reference. within 7 working days your account would be closed (if you do not hold any demat balance). within 15 days you’d receive a letter from Sharekhan confirming the closure
